Introducon
Thank you for purchasing this six-unit rapid charger from 49er Communicaons. It’s a high quality product is designed for use with
up to six rechargeable two-way radio baeries. With the appropriate charging pod installed, it can charge baeries with these cell
types: nickel cadmium (NiCd), nickel-metal hydride (NiMH), lithium ion (Li-Ion), or lithium polymer (LiPo).

1. Read and follow these instrucons. Heed all warnings. Keep
this user manual for future reference.
2. Do not operate this charger near water or where moisture
is present. Do not operate this charger where it could be ex-
posed to dripping, splashing, or spray from water or other
liquids. Do not place containers with liquids, such as so
drinks or ower vases, on or near the charger. Clean with a
dry cloth.
3. Follow all installaon guidelines. Do not block any venlaon
openings on the charger. Do not place near any heat sources
such as radiators, heat registers, stoves, ampliers, or other
devices that produce heat.
4. Only use the power supply provided with this charger. For
safety reasons, do not modify the grounding type plug on
the power cord. The grounding type plug has two blades and
a third grounding prong. If this plug does not t into your
outlet, consult a qualied electrician for replacement.
5. Protect the power supply and cords from being walked on.
Do not allow the power cord to be pinched or bent at a sharp
angle, parcularly near the wall outlet or where it connects
to the charger.
6. Only use aachments / accessories supplied with this char-
ger or specied by 49er Communicaons.
7. Unplug this charger during lightning storms or when not
used for an extended period of me.
8. Refer all repairs for servicing to qualied service personnel.
Servicing is required when the charger has been damaged in
any way. This includes dropping the charger, spilling liquids
on the charger, causing objects to fall into the charger, exces-
sive wear to the power cord or plug, exposing the charger
to rain or moisture, or when the charger fails to operate in a
normal manner.

Cauon
1. Never charge alkaline or dry cell baeries with this charger. Do not charge NiCd, NiMH, Li-Ion, or LiPo baeries unless they are
designed with overcharge protecon.
2. Do not aempt to charge a baery without rst conrming that the appropriate charging pod is installed.
3. Disconnect charger from the power supply before installing, adjusng, removing, or cleaning the charging pod.
4. Use only charging pods and the power supply designed for this charger. Using similar parts available from other manufacturers
may damage the charger or baeries.
5. Make sure the contacts in the charging pod and on the baery are clean, otherwise the baery may not fully charge.
6. Do not allow wire or metal objects to touch contacts in the charging pod or any internal part of the charger.
7. Do not remove the charger’s housing or make any modicaon to the charger.
8. Turn charger o when not in use. The power on / o switch is located on the right side of the charger.
9. Always charge new baeries completely before inial use. Do not charge baeries that have been exposed to excessive heat.
10. Recycle baeries when they can no longer be used. Do not discard unwanted baeries in the trash or incinerate. Baeries ex-
posed to re or excessive heat may explode.
